Strawberry Statistics Back to top
- Population (2000): 5,302
- Land Area (2000): 3.520 square kilometers
- Water Area (2000): 0.039 square kilometers
Houses (2000): 2,513

Strawberry Hours Worked Per Week In 1999
Hours Per Week |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
35 or more hours | 2,481 | 55.73% |
15-35 hours | 691 | 15.52% |
1-14 hours | 193 | 4.34% |
No regular hours | 1,087 | 24.42% |
Strawberry Time Left For Work
Time |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
Midnight-4:59 AM | 41 | 1.52% |
5 AM-5:29 AM | 62 | 2.30% |
5:30 AM-5:59 AM | 29 | 1.08% |
6 AM-6:29 AM | 96 | 3.56% |
6:30 AM-6:59 AM | 193 | 7.16% |
7 AM-7:29 AM | 357 | 13.25% |
7:30 AM-7:59 AM | 362 | 13.44% |
8 AM-8:29 AM | 365 | 13.55% |
8:30 AM-8:59 AM | 253 | 9.39% |
9:00 AM-9:59 AM | 457 | 16.96% |
10:00 AM-10:59 AM | 176 | 6.53% |
11:00 AM-11:59 AM | 33 | 1.22% |
Noon-3:59 PM | 158 | 5.86% |
4 PM-11:59 PM | 112 | 4.16% |
Strawberry Length Of Commute In Minutes
Minutes |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
Less than 5 | 120 | 4.45% |
5-9 | 281 | 10.43% |
10-14 | 378 | 14.03% |
15-19 | 404 | 15.00% |
20-24 | 202 | 7.50% |
25-29 | 121 | 4.49% |
30-34 | 466 | 17.30% |
35-39 | 108 | 4.01% |
40-44 | 211 | 7.83% |
45-59 | 248 | 9.21% |
60-89 | 114 | 4.23% |
At least 90 | 41 | 1.52% |
Strawberry Length Of Commute In Mintues - Public vs. Private Transportation
Minutes | Population (public) | Percent | Population (private) | Percent |
---|---|---|---|---|
Under 30 | 23 | 0.85% | 1,483 | 55.05% |
30-44 | 129 | 4.79% | 656 | 24.35% |
45-59 | 70 | 2.60% | 178 | 6.61% |
At least 60 | 42 | 1.56% | 113 | 4.19% |
Strawberry Type Of Commute
Type |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
Bicycle | 20 | 0.69% |
Car / truck / van, carpool | 390 | 13.37% |
Car / truck / van, solo | 1,881 | 64.51% |
Motorcycle | 0 | 0.00% |
Other | 0 | 0.00% |
Public transportation | 264 | 9.05% |
Walked | 139 | 4.77% |
Worked at home | 222 | 7.61% |

Strawberry Family Information Back to top
Households (2000): 2,437 (5,105 people)
Families (2000): 1,245 (3,520 people)
Families where both partners work (2000): 600
People at same address in 1995: 2,599
Strawberry Household Income in 1999
Income |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
Under $10,000 | 154 | 6.32% |
$10,000-$14,999 | 91 | 3.73% |
$15,000-$19,999 | 114 | 4.68% |
$20,000-$24,999 | 86 | 3.53% |
$25,000-$29,999 | 60 | 2.46% |
$30,000-$34,999 | 81 | 3.32% |
$35,000-$39,999 | 96 | 3.94% |
$40,000-$44,999 | 135 | 5.54% |
$45,000-$49,999 | 99 | 4.06% |
$50,000-$59,999 | 167 | 6.85% |
$60,000-$74,999 | 221 | 9.07% |
$75,000-$99,999 | 281 | 11.53% |
$100,000-$124,999 | 217 | 8.90% |
$125,000-$149,999 | 127 | 5.21% |
$150,000-$199,999 | 194 | 7.96% |
$200,000 or more | 314 | 12.88% |
Strawberry Household Type
Type |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
Nonfamily, 1 person | 945 | 38.81% |
Family, 2 people | 620 | 25.46% |
Nonfamily, 2 people | 204 | 8.38% |
Family, 3 people | 302 | 12.40% |
Nonfamily, 3 people | 30 | 1.23% |
Family, 4 people | 231 | 9.49% |
Nonfamily, 4 people | 8 | 0.33% |
Family, 5 people | 71 | 2.92% |
Nonfamily, 5 people | 1 | 0.04% |
Family, 6 people | 15 | 0.62% |
Nonfamily, 6 people | 1 | 0.04% |
Family, 7 or more people | 7 | 0.29% |
Nonfamily, 7 or more people | 0 | 0.00% |
Strawberry Household Income Type
Type |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
Earnings | 2,059 | 29.55% |
Interest / Dividend / Rent | 1,256 | 18.03% |
Public Assistance | 48 | 0.69% |
Retirement | 306 | 4.39% |
Self Employment | 652 | 9.36% |
Social Security | 514 | 7.38% |
Supplemental Security | 49 | 0.70% |
Wage / Salary | 1,823 | 26.17% |
Other | 260 | 3.73% |
Strawberry Family Type
Type |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
No children under 18 | 568 | 54.67% |
With children under 18 | 471 | 45.33% |
Strawberry Marital Status - Male (for those 15+ in 2000)
Type |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
Divorced | 272 | 12.76% |
Married | 1,121 | 52.58% |
Never Married | 707 | 33.16% |
Widowed | 32 | 1.50% |
Strawberry Marital Status - Female (for those 15+ in 2000)
Type |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
Divorced | 344 | 14.43% |
Married | 1,141 | 47.86% |
Never Married | 736 | 30.87% |
Widowed | 163 | 6.84% |

Strawberry Education Information Back to top
Strawberry Highest Degree Earned (18 or older)
Degree |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
Less than 9th grade | 88 | 2.01% |
9th-12th grade, no diploma | 97 | 2.21% |
High school diploma or equivalent | 424 | 9.67% |
Some college, no degree | 837 | 19.08% |
Associate degree | 332 | 7.57% |
Bachelors degree | 1,661 | 37.87% |
Graduate or professional degree | 947 | 21.59% |
Strawberry Population In School (3 or older)
School Level | In Public School | Percent | In Private School | Percent | Total | Percent |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Nursery or preschool | 23 | 0.43% | 63 | 1.19% | 86 | 1.62% |
Kindergarten | 35 | 0.66% | 11 | 0.21% | 46 | 0.87% |
Grades 1-4 | 194 | 3.66% | 69 | 1.30% | 263 | 4.96% |
Grades 5-8 | 134 | 2.53% | 102 | 1.92% | 236 | 4.45% |
Grades 9-12 | 171 | 3.23% | 26 | 0.49% | 197 | 3.72% |
Undergrad college | 221 | 4.17% | 136 | 2.57% | 357 | 6.73% |
Graduate or professional school | 65 | 1.23% | 272 | 5.13% | 337 | 6.36% |
Total | 843 | 15.90% | 679 | 12.81% | 1,522 | 28.71% |
